Recovery Uranium from Uranium-Bearing Waste Ore Using Heap Bioleaching

2012 
The feasibility of heap bioleaching recovery of uranium from the one Uranium Mine deposit uranium-bearing waste ore, located in south of China, were investigated. A 4500 ton industrial heap was constructed in the waste ore dump site. The waste ore sample was crushed to -25 mm, the ore uranium grade is 0.0211%. After 146 days of performance, the slag uranium leaching rate was 55.92% that calculated by its residue has been recovered, content of uranium in residue was 0.0093%, the acid consumption rate was 2.69% by ore weight. The study has proven that recovery uranium from uranium-bearing waste ore using heap bioleaching is feasible.
